Hướng dẫn wordpress display posts on page php - wordpress hiển thị bài viết trên trang php

Cách tạo trang blog WordPress bằng các tùy chọn mặc định

Một trong những chức năng WordPress mặc định là hiển thị các bài đăng mới nhất của bạn trên trang chủ của bạn. Tuy nhiên, người dùng thường muốn phân biệt giữa trang chủ của họ và trang có chứa các bài đăng. Điều này có thể dễ dàng đặt vì đây là một trong những tùy chọn WordPress mặc định, nằm trong phần Cài đặt.

Một điều kiện tiên quyết cho phương pháp này là có một trang trống [không có nội dung trước đó], sẽ phục vụ để hiển thị tất cả các bài đăng của bạn. Nếu bạn không có một trang như vậy, hãy tạo nó bằng cách điều hướng đến các trang> Thêm mới. Thêm một tên thích hợp vào trang [ví dụ: blog] và nhấn nút xuất bản.navigating to Pages > Add New. Add an appropriate name to the page [e.g. Blog], and press the Publish button.

Khi bạn đã tạo trang, điều hướng đến Cài đặt> Đọc. Dưới trang chủ của bạn hiển thị chọn tùy chọn cho một trang tĩnh. Điều này sẽ cho phép bạn chọn một trang làm trang chủ của bạn và một trang khác làm trang bài đăng của bạn. Tùy chọn thứ hai là những gì chúng tôi quan tâm. Bạn sẽ sử dụng trang trống bạn đã tạo trước đó và đặt nó làm trang bài đăng của bạn bằng cách tìm và chọn nó từ menu thả xuống. Sau đó, nhấn nút Lưu thay đổi bên dưới.navigate to Settings > Reading. Under Your homepage displays choose the option for A static page. This will enable you to select one page as your homepage and another page as your Posts page. The latter option is what we are interested in. You’re going to use the blank page you created earlier and set it as your Posts page by finding and selecting it from the dropdown menu. Then, press the Save Changes button below.

Điều này sẽ hiển thị tất cả các bài đăng WordPress trên một trang đó và chúng sẽ được cách điệu dựa trên chủ đề bạn đang sử dụng. Một cài đặt bổ sung mà bạn nên biết là các trang blog hiển thị nhiều nhất, có thể thấy trên ảnh chụp màn hình ở trên. Giá trị mặc định của nó được đặt thành 10, có nghĩa là nó sẽ hiển thị tối đa 10 bài đăng trên một trang. Do đó, nếu trang web của bạn có hơn 10 bài đăng, trang blog WordPress mới được tạo của bạn sẽ có tính năng phân trang gần phía dưới, cho phép người đọc thấy có bao nhiêu trang nội dung trong blog của bạn.the Blog pages show at most option, which can be seen on the screenshot above. Its default value is set to 10, meaning it will show up to 10 posts on a single page. Therefore, if your website has more than 10 posts, your newly created WordPress blog page will have a pagination feature near the bottom, letting readers see how many pages of content there are in your blog.

Tuy nhiên, nếu bạn không muốn có tính năng phân trang và muốn hiển thị tất cả các bài đăng trên trang blog WordPress của bạn, bạn có thể làm điều đó. Chỉ cần chèn một số lớn hơn số bài đăng hiện tại của bạn trên trang web. Nhưng, hãy xem xét rằng điều này có hai nhược điểm nghiêm trọng. Một số lượng lớn các bài đăng sẽ tăng thời gian trang blog của bạn mất để tải, cũng như làm cho trang rất dài và khó cuộn qua.

Sau khi bạn điều chỉnh số lượng bài viết sẽ được hiển thị trên mỗi trang, bạn đã hoàn thành. Điều duy nhất còn lại là kiểm tra trang bài viết của bạn. Tùy thuộc vào chủ đề mà bạn sử dụng, nó có thể trông giống như ảnh chụp màn hình được đưa ra dưới đây.check your Posts page. Depending on the theme you’re using, it might look like the screenshot given below.

Tuy nhiên, nếu bạn nhận ra rằng bạn không tìm thấy thiết kế của trang bài đăng của mình, chúng tôi khuyên bạn nên chọn trang bạn chọn làm trang bài đăng của bạn và thử một số đề xuất khác của chúng tôi dưới đây.if you realize you don’t find the design of your Posts page appealing, we advise unselecting the page you choose as your Posts page and trying some of our other suggestions below.

Cách tạo trang blog WordPress bằng cách sử dụng các mẫu trang blog cụ thể theo chủ đề

Nếu bạn không muốn sử dụng chức năng trang WordPress Post hoặc không thích thiết kế của nó, bạn nên xem liệu chủ đề bạn đang sử dụng có mẫu trang phù hợp với nhu cầu của bạn không. Các chủ đề thường sẽ bao gồm các mẫu trang liên quan đến blog, vì vậy bạn nên điều tra nếu đây cũng là trường hợp với chủ đề bạn hiện đang sử dụng.

Kiểm tra điều này là dễ dàng. Bạn chỉ cần nhấp để chỉnh sửa một trang và sau đó định vị phần Thuộc tính trang ở phía bên phải của màn hình. Khi bạn nhấp vào danh sách thả xuống bên cạnh mẫu: Tùy chọn, bạn sẽ thấy danh sách các mẫu trang có sẵn trong chủ đề của bạn. Tìm kiếm các mẫu có chứa blog từ. Trong trường hợp bạn thấy có nhiều mẫu có sẵn, hãy đảm bảo kiểm tra tất cả, để tìm ra mẫu mà hấp dẫn nhất đối với bạn. Bạn có thể làm điều đó chỉ bằng cách chọn một mẫu và nhấn nút cập nhật để cập nhật trang.click to edit a page and then locate the Page Attributes section on the right side of the screen. When you click on the dropdown next to the Template: option, you will see the list of page templates available within your theme. Look for templates that contain the word Blog. In case you find there are multiple templates available, make sure to examine them all, to find the one that’s most appealing to you. You can do that simply by selecting a template and pressing the Update button to update the page.

Sau đó, hãy kiểm tra trang sẽ chứa tất cả các bài đăng WordPress của bạn. Tùy thuộc vào chủ đề mà bạn sử dụng, nó có thể trông giống như ảnh chụp màn hình của chúng tôi dưới đây.check the page which will contain all your WordPress posts. Depending on the theme you’re using, it might look similar to our screenshot below.

Lặp lại quy trình tương tự cho tất cả các mẫu trang liên quan đến blog có sẵn của bạn cho đến khi bạn tìm thấy trang bạn thích. Tuy nhiên, nếu chủ đề của bạn không có các mẫu trang có liên quan hoặc bạn không hài lòng với giao diện của các mẫu trang bạn đã kiểm tra, hãy thử một trong những đề xuất khác của chúng tôi.If, however, your theme doesn’t have relevant page templates or you aren’t satisfied with the look of the page templates you checked, try one of our other suggestions.

Hiển thị tất cả các bài đăng trên blog của bạn bằng plugin

Một trong những lợi thế lớn nhất của WordPress là rất nhiều plugin mà nó đã phát triển cho hầu hết mọi mục đích. Do đó, để giải quyết vấn đề hoặc thêm một tính năng, bạn thường sẽ cần điều tra và kiểm tra một số plugin nhất định.

Đầu tiên, hãy xem liệu các plugin bạn đã hoạt động trên trang web của mình có chứa tùy chọn hay mã ngắn có thể giúp hiển thị tất cả các bài đăng WordPress của bạn trên một trang. Quá trình này khác nhau rất nhiều dựa trên các plugin bạn đang sử dụng, vì vậy chúng tôi có thể cung cấp cho bạn bất kỳ hướng dẫn phổ quát nào về vấn đề này. Nếu bạn không thể tìm thấy một tùy chọn hoặc mã ngắn phù hợp, hãy khám phá các plugin WordPress có sẵn.

Hiển thị bài đăng của bạn trong Elementor bằng plugin

Nếu bạn là người dùng Elementor, bạn có thể muốn kiểm tra Qi Addons cho Elementor, bộ sưu tập tiện ích lớn nhất cho các mục đích khác nhau. Một trong số đó là Widget Danh sách blog, một công cụ nhỏ tiện dụng để tổ chức các bài đăng trên blog của bạn thành danh sách và hiển thị chúng trên trang của bạn.

Sau khi bạn cài đặt và kích hoạt plugin, chỉ cần chọn phần tử danh sách blog từ menu, thêm nó bất cứ nơi nào bạn thấy phù hợp và tùy chỉnh nó theo ý thích của bạn.

Lưu ý rằng với plugin này, bạn cũng có thể sử dụng bất kỳ vật dụng nào khác trong số 150 tiện ích khác đi kèm với nó, không chỉ danh sách blog. Nó đi kèm với các tùy chọn đánh máy và viết blog rộng rãi, cũng như giới thiệu addons, SEO và các yếu tố kinh doanh và nhiều hơn nữa.

Hiển thị bài đăng của bạn trong Gutenberg bằng plugin

Đối với những người thích Gutenberg, chúng tôi có một giải pháp hữu ích và phong cách tương tự. Khối QI cho Gutenberg là một tập hợp hơn 80 khối Gutenberg độc quyền và là bộ sưu tập bạn sẽ cần cho chủ đề của bài viết này là danh sách blog. Sau khi cài đặt plugin [có phiên bản miễn phí và cao cấp và khối danh sách blog trong số các loại miễn phí], bạn sẽ nhận được một lựa chọn các khối để bổ sung cho các khối Gutenberg mặc định của bạn. Thêm danh sách blog vào trang của bạn và tiến hành tạo kiểu nó bằng các tùy chọn khối trực quan và thân thiện với người mới bắt đầu.

Khối cho phép bạn đặt hình ảnh, ngày xuất bản, danh mục, thông tin tác giả và nhiều hơn nữa. Bạn có thể thay đổi màu sắc, phông chữ, thêm hoặc xóa các nút và nhãn và nhiều hơn nữa.

Hiển thị bài đăng của bạn bằng WP Hiển thị bài đăng

Nếu không có tùy chọn nào ở trên phù hợp với bạn [mà chúng tôi nghi ngờ], bạn có thể cho WP Show Post một cảnh quay. Plugin này hoạt động bằng cách tạo mã ngắn bạn có thể đăng bất cứ nơi nào bạn muốn hiển thị các bài đăng trên blog của mình. Bạn có thể đặt tiêu đề, chọn phân loại để hiển thị, đặt phân trang và thay đổi số lượng bài đăng trên mỗi trang.

Bạn có thể đi qua các tab tùy chọn còn lại để điều chỉnh các tùy chọn sẽ liên quan đến bạn. Trong số những người khác, các tab này bao gồm các tùy chọn liên quan đến số lượng cột và khoảng cách giữa các cột, liệu bài đăng có chứa hình ảnh nổi bật của nó, cũng như căn chỉnh và vị trí của hình ảnh đó. Có các tùy chọn liên quan đến độ dài của đoạn trích, khả năng đổi tên nút đọc thêm, lựa chọn để thêm siêu dữ liệu có liên quan [tác giả, ngày, danh mục], cũng như để loại trừ một số bài đăng [bằng ID hoặc tác giả] và điều chỉnh đặt hàng đặt hàng quy tắc.

Kiểm tra cẩn thận và điều chỉnh các tùy chọn này. Khi bạn hoàn thành, nhấn nút xuất bản ở phần bên phải của màn hình. Sau đó, sao chép mã shortcode từ phần sử dụng ở bên phải. When you’re done, press the Publish button in the right section of the screen. Then, copy the shortcode from the Usage section on the right.

Bạn cần dán mã ngắn này bên trong trang của bạn. Tùy thuộc vào bạn đang sử dụng trình tạo trang nào, quá trình này có thể thay đổi. Trong Gutenberg, bạn sẽ sử dụng khối shortcode. Trong Elementor, bạn sẽ cần phần tử trình soạn thảo văn bản và trong WPBakery sử dụng phần tử khối văn bản.paste this shortcode inside your page. Depending on which page builder you are using, this process can vary. In Gutenberg, you will use the Shortcode block. In Elementor, you will need the Text Editor element, and in WPBakery use the Text Block element.

Sau khi chèn mã shortcode bằng cách sử dụng Trình tạo trang ưa thích của bạn, hãy kiểm tra trang. Tùy thuộc vào thiết kế và tùy chọn được chọn của bạn được đặt trong plugin, trang của bạn có thể trông giống như ảnh chụp màn hình của chúng tôi.check the page. Depending on your chosen design and options set in the plugin, your page might look similar to our screenshot.

Cách tạo mẫu blog tùy chỉnh của bạn

Nếu bạn đã thử các đề xuất trước đây của chúng tôi nhưng không thích trang kết quả, thì cách tốt nhất để bạn sử dụng mã để tạo trang blog WordPress của bạn. Tuy nhiên, chúng tôi không khuyên điều này cho bất kỳ người dùng WordPress mới nào, vì nó đòi hỏi kiến ​​thức mã hóa quan trọng, cũng như việc sử dụng FTP. Nhưng nếu bạn quyết định thử phương thức này, chúng tôi khuyên bạn nên sao lưu trang web của mình trước khi cố gắng tạo một mẫu tùy chỉnh. Hãy nhớ rằng bất kỳ lỗi mã hóa có thể phá vỡ trang web của bạn.

Bước đầu tiên để tạo mẫu trang tùy chỉnh là tạo một tệp mới tại vị trí thích hợp và đặt tên đầy đủ. Để làm như vậy, kết nối với máy chủ của bạn bằng thông tin đăng nhập FTP của bạn và điều hướng đến thư mục WordPress gốc của bạn. Sau đó, điều hướng đến thư mục của chủ đề bạn hiện đang sử dụng, tức là/thư mục/tên chủ đề/tên chủ đề/thư mục chủ đề. Nhấp chuột phải vào thư mục đó trong khi đảm bảo không nhấp vào bất kỳ tệp nào của các thư mục con được tìm thấy ở đó. Sau đó, nhấp vào tùy chọn Tạo tệp mới từ menu xuất hiện.connect to your server using your FTP credentials and navigate to your root WordPress directory. Then, navigate to the directory of the theme you are currently using, i.e. the /wp-content/themes/theme-name/ directory. Right-click within that directory while making sure not to click on any of the files of subfolders found there. Then, click on the Create new file option from the menu that appears.

Tên tệp phải được viết chữ thường, với phần mở rộng .php ở cuối. Trong trường hợp nhiều từ, thay vì không gian, sử dụng dấu gạch nối [-] giữa các từ. Có nghĩa là, đặt tên cho tệp theo định dạng sau: tên của bạn-file.php, sau đó bạn nên nhấn nút OK.name the file in the following format: your-file-name.php, after which you should press the Ok button.

Điều này sẽ tạo một tệp .php trống nơi bạn cần thêm mã phù hợp cho mẫu trang của mình.

Để tạo một mẫu trang hiển thị tất cả các bài đăng, bạn chỉ cần triển khai vòng lặp WordPress. Vì mã hóa một mẫu trang từ đầu có thể khá khó khăn, bạn luôn có thể sử dụng mã từ tệp page.php của chủ đề của bạn làm đường cơ sở, sau đó điều chỉnh nó theo nhu cầu của bạn. Ngoài ra, bạn cũng có thể sử dụng mẫu trang chúng tôi đã tạo cho bài viết này.page.php file of your theme as a baseline, and then adjust it according to your needs. Additionally, you can also use the page template we created for this article.

Bài Viết Liên Quan

Chủ Đề